Wilson Chandler
With the New York Knicks and the Denver Nuggets, Wilson Chandler was a role player that was good at what he did. And he did everything.
Averaging more than 15 points and almost six rebounds per game off the bench, Chandler was one of the best role players in the NBA last season.
Chandler can be the player that takes the spot of Dwyane Wayne or LeBron James when they need to rest.
Glen Davis
The Boston Celtics may not be able to retain their big center Glen Davis, but Miami would love to have the Big Baby over to stay.
The enormous center has come into his own as a defensive staple during his time with the Celtics. That’s exactly what the Heat have been looking for.
Davis is an emotional player, and his history with the Celtics will rejuvenate the Heat’s hunt for a championship.
JJ Barea
The Miami Heat need help at the point guard position every season, but there isn’t a better backup point guard to Mario Chalmers than familiar foe JJ Barea.
Miami can keep Barea in the bench role that he had when he destroyed teams—including Miami—on the Dallas Mavericks' road to the NBA Championship.
While this wouldn’t improve the Heat's lack of a presence down low, Barea would be too good to pass up if he shows interest in signing with the team for a reasonable price.
